首页> 外文期刊>Physics in medicine and biology. >DagSolid: A new Geant4 solid class for fast simulation in polygon-mesh geometry
【24h】

DagSolid: A new Geant4 solid class for fast simulation in polygon-mesh geometry

机译:DagSolid:新的Geant4实体类,用于在多边形网格几何图形中进行快速仿真

获取原文
获取原文并翻译 | 示例
           

摘要

Even though a computer-aided design (CAD)-based geometry can be directly implemented in Geant4 as polygon-mesh using the G4TessellatedSolid class, the computation speed becomes very slow, especially when the geometry is composed of a large number of facets. To address this problem, in the present study, a new Geant4 solid class, named DagSolid, was developed based on the direct accelerated geometry for the Monte Carlo (DAGMC) library which provides the ray-tracing acceleration algorithm functions. To develop the DagSolid class, the new solid class was derived from the G4VSolid class, and its ray-tracing functions were linked to the corresponding functions of the DAGMC library. The results of this study show that the use of the DagSolid class drastically improves the computation speed. The improvement was more significant when there were more facets, meaning that the DagSolid class can be used more effectively for complicated geometries with many facets than for simple geometries. The maximum difference of computation speed was 1562 and 680 times for Geantino and ChargedGeantino, respectively. For real particles (gammas, electrons, neutrons, and protons), the difference of computation speed was less significant, but still was within the range of 53-685 times depending on the type of beam particles simulated.
机译:即使可以使用G4TessellatedSolid类在Geant4中将基于计算机辅助设计(CAD)的几何图形直接实现为多边形网格,但计算速度仍然非常慢,特别是当几何图形由大量的构面组成时。为了解决这个问题,在本研究中,基于蒙特卡洛(DAGMC)库的直接加速几何体,开发了一个名为DagSolid的新Geant4实体类,该类提供了光线跟踪加速算法功能。为了开发DagSolid类,新的solid类是从G4VSolid类派生的,并将其光线跟踪功能链接到DAGMC库的相应功能。这项研究的结果表明,使用DagSolid类可以大大提高计算速度。当有更多的构面时,改进更为显着,这意味着与简单的几何体相比,DagSolid类可以更有效地用于具有多个构面的复杂几何体。 Geantino和ChargedGeantino的最大计算速度差异分别是1562和680倍。对于真实粒子(配子,电子,中子和质子),计算速度的差异不那么显着,但仍在53-685倍的范围内,具体取决于模拟的粒子束的类型。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号